Factors Affecting Cost
- Length of the Drain: Longer drains require more materials and labor, increasing the overall cost.
- Depth of the Drain: Deeper installations are more labor-intensive and may require specialized equipment.
- Soil Type: Certain soil types, such as clay, are harder to excavate and can raise labor costs.
- Accessibility: Hard-to-reach areas may need additional labor and equipment, adding to the expense.
-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may require permits and inspections, which add to the cost.
- Material Quality: Higher-quality materials, such as perforated pipes and gravel, can increase the price.
- Landscaping: Restoring landscaping after installation can add to the overall cost.
- Additional Features: Adding features like sump pumps or catch basins will increase the expense.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(Lancaster, OH) |
---|---|
Installation per linear foot | $25 - $35 |
Excavation per hour | $50 - $75 |
Gravel and pipe materials | $500 - $1,000 |
Permits and inspections | $100 - $300 |
Landscaping restoration | $200 - $500 |
Sump pump installation | $800 - $1,200 |
Catch basin installation | $300 - $600 |
